草庐IT

NATIVE_URI

全部标签

android - 如何在 React Native 中存储/保存数据

如何在reactnative中存储/保存数据。就像我们在android中使用shared-preference,reactnative有什么解决方案吗?我是新手react活跃。pleaseaddsampleexample 最佳答案 您可以使用ReactNativeAsyncStorage用于将数据存储到设备的本地存储。importAsyncStoragefrom'@react-native-async-storage/async-storage';用这个来保存数据AsyncStorage.setItem('key','value')

android - 如何在 React Native 应用程序名称中添加空格?

如何在应用程序名称中添加空格?比如,如果我这样做react-nativeinitHelloWorld它将创建一个名为HelloWorld的应用程序。但是如果我这样做$react-nativeinit"HelloWorld""HelloWorld"isnotavalidnameforaproject.Pleaseuseavalididentifiername(alphanumeric).有没有办法在项目名称中添加空格?我找到了适用于iOS的解决方案(https://github.com/facebook/react-native/issues/6115),但我正在为Android开发。请

android - React Native - 如何从 MainActivity.java 向 RN 发出事件?

在ReactNativeAppState库中:iOS有三种状态background->inactive->activeAndroid只有background->active当Android应用程序完全后台运行时,MainActivity从onPause->onStop当有系统通知时,例如应用内购买会转到onPause当应用程序从后台转到前台时,我需要运行一些代码onStop->onResume如果应用程序因系统通知而短暂暂停,我不希望它运行onPause->onResume这可能吗?React的生命周期事件没有onHostStop我尝试从MainActivity为每个Activity生

android - 在 React Native 中调试 Android WebViews

我需要检查我在我的应用程序中运行的WebView的内容和网络请求。使用iOS,我可以打开模拟器,打开Safari,然后可以像检查任何其他网站一样检查webview。我在使用Android时遇到问题。我已经转到chrome://inspect,并且能够在连接的设备上检查Chrome,但是我无法检查webview。我尝试将ReactWebViewManager.java中的webView.setWebContentsDebuggingEnabled(true);移动到onPageStarted方法中,以便它始终处于启用状态,但这没有任何效果。谢谢 最佳答案

app安全之安卓native层安全分析(二):unidbg+ida使用+过签名校验

前言继续跟着龙哥的unidbg学习:SO入门实战教程二:calculateS_so_白龙~的博客-CSDN博客还是那句,我会借鉴龙哥的文章,以一个初学者的角度,加上自己的理解,把内容丰富一下,尽量做到不在龙哥的基础上画蛇添足,哈哈。感谢观看的朋友分析首先抓包分析:其中,里面的s就是今天的需要分析的加密参数了。调试老样子,打开jadx,发现没壳,可以的,直接看吧,拿着这几个参数一顿搜,直接搜【p】感觉有两个地方很可疑,进去一看:跟下调用栈,很快就找到这里:ok,用objectionhook下,发现确实调用了这里再仔细看看这里,明显这里很奇怪了ok,终于到这里了,这里就跟龙哥给的位置一致了先不急着

android - 从 Intent.ACTION_GET_CONTENT 到文件的 URI

使用Intent.ACTION_GET_CONTENT启动照片选择器检索所选项目的URI检索URI的路径,以便我可以将其发布到我的网络服务器启动浏览的代码Intentintent=newIntent(Intent.ACTION_GET_CONTENT);intent.setType("image/*");startActivityForResult(intent,BROWSE_IMAGE_REQUEST_CODE);检索所选图像的代码if(RESULT_OK==resultCode&&BROWSE_IMAGE_REQUEST_CODE==requestCode){Uriuri=data

android - React native 如何每 x 分钟从 api 中获取一次

我想在android上每x分钟运行一次获取(使用Reactnative)functiongetMoviesFromApiAsync(){returnfetch('https://facebook.github.io/react-native/movies.json').then((response)=>response.json()).then((responseJson)=>{returnresponseJson.movies;}).catch((error)=>{console.error(error);});}我使用了documentaion中的示例,因为我仍然不确定我将如何进行

android - 如何使用 SharedPreferences 来保存 URI 或任何存储?

URIimageUri=null;//SettingtheUriofaURLtoimageUri.try{imageUri=aURL.toURI();}catch(URISyntaxExceptione1){//TODOAuto-generatedcatchblocke1.printStackTrace();}我正在使用此代码将URL转换为URI。我怎样才能将imageUri保存到SharedPreferences,或者在它不会被onDestroy()删除的内存中?我不想做SQLite数据库,因为URI会随着URL的改变而改变。我不想为未使用的URI耗尽内存

android - 新的 admob Express Native 广告因 IllegalStateException 而失败

我一直在尝试将快速原生广告集成到我的应用程序中。在expressnativeads文档中,我读到它们在以FULL_WIDTH广告尺寸显示时效果最佳。我尝试将我的广告尺寸设置为FULL_WIDTH,但失败并出现IllegalStateException:Causedby:java.lang.IllegalStateException:TheadsizeandadunitIDmustbesetbeforeloadAdiscalled.这是我的xml代码:广告单元正确,适用于其他广告尺寸,例如320x150等。我的实现有问题吗?干杯 最佳答案

javascript - 未定义不是 this.state 中的对象 - React Native

我是ReactNative的新手,我在this.state.rows中收到错误消息undefinedisnotaobject我我正在尝试在用户单击Button时动态添加View。我尝试使用this而不是使用getInitialState我使用constructor(props)但我一直有上述错误。这是我的代码constructor(props){super(props);this.state={rows:[],};}addRow(){this.state.rows.push(index++)this.setState({rows:this.state.rows})}render(){l